Cristian Garin
Cristian Garin is a professional Chilean tennis player known for his powerful playing style and strong performances on clay courts. He is recognized as one of Chile's top tennis talents and has been involved in notable matches in international competitions.
Born on May 30, 1996 (29 years old)
